①There are many causes of headaches, mainly because pain-sensitive structures inside and outside the skull are stimulated, which are transmitted to the cerebral cortex through the pain center. It mainly includes the following aspects:

1. Intracranial diseases

Such as intracranial infectious diseases, intracranial vascular diseases, intracranial space-occupying lesions, etc.

2. Extracranial diseases

Such as neuralgia caused by bone diseases, temporal arteritis, headaches caused by eyes, ears, nose, and teeth, etc.;

3. Neurosis

Such as acute and chronic systemic infection, cardiovascular disease, poisoning, heat stroke, headache caused by uremia, etc.;

4. Systemic diseases

Such as neurasthenia, hysteria, etc.

Clinical type

1. Vascular

It is caused by high blood pressure, low blood pressure, inflammation, hot or cold stimulation, fatigue, lack of sleep, drinking, etc., and is mostly characterized by continuous swelling or throbbing pain in the entire head or local area. Because the causes of this type of headache come from blood vessels, they are collectively called vascular headaches. Headache caused by vasomotor dysfunction in the head is called primary vascular headache; headache caused by clear cerebrovascular disease (such as stroke, intracranial hematoma, cerebral vasculitis, etc.) is called secondary headache.

2. Neurological

The cause is unknown or it may be caused by nerve irritation, and it is mostly paroxysmal stabbing or shooting pain in irregular locations.

3. Muscle tension

Most of them are caused by inflammation, ischemia and strain of the neck muscles; some are induced by tension, fatigue, noisy environment, glaring light, etc., and are more common in young and middle-aged people, especially women. The main symptoms are soreness and swelling in the occipital area, shoulders and arms, centered around the neck.

4. Stress

It is caused by various reasons that lead to increased or decreased intracranial pressure, such as intracranial tumors, meningitis, cerebrospinal fluid leakage, etc. It is characterized by persistent bloating and pain, or accompanied by nausea and vomiting. Certain body positions may cause this type of headache to worsen or ease.

5. Damage

It is caused by craniocerebral trauma and may present as severe dull pain, distending pain, or throbbing pain, which may be accompanied by changes in consciousness.

6. Epileptic

It occurs before or after an epileptic seizure and may present as a full-head pain or paroxysmal throbbing, stabbing, or shooting pains, and may be accompanied by nausea and vomiting.

7. Sympathetic

It is caused by stimulation of the posterior cervical sympathetic nerves, mostly located in the occipital region, and can radiate to the surrounding areas. Symptoms are similar to vascular headaches, and may be accompanied by eye pain, tinnitus, dizziness, visual impairment, tearing, etc.

8. Diffusion

Caused by diseases of the eyes, ears, nose, trigeminal nerve and occipital nerve, such as glaucoma, refractive error, sinusitis, otitis media, mastoiditis, dental caries, alveolar abscess, cervical spine or paraspinal soft tissue diseases, etc.

9. Infectivity

It generally refers to headaches caused by infections outside the brain (such as colds, upper respiratory tract infections, pneumonia, etc., especially those accompanied by fever). Most of the time, there is swelling and pain in the whole head, and the characteristics are the same as vascular headaches. It improves as the infection improves.

10. Toxicity

Such as acute alcohol poisoning, carbon monoxide poisoning, lead, benzene, nitrate poisoning, etc.
